Job Description

We are looking for a sharp, agile, and strategic Manager, Financial Planning and Analysis to join our fast-paced team. Reporting to the Senior Director, Strategic Finance, this isn’t a role where you’ll hide behind spreadsheets all day. While you must be a master of the data, your true value lies in your ability to translate complex numbers into actionable business strategies and partner directly with our executive leadership team. As a finance leader in a high-growth startup environment, you will have a massive impact on our trajectory. You will own our consolidation process, drive critical business decisions through rigorous financial analysis, and act as a trusted advisor to senior stakeholders. YOU WILL: - Strategic Business Partnering: Act as a core financial advisor to executive leadership and department heads. Translate financial metrics into narrative insights that drive strategic growth, resource allocation, and operational efficiency. - Financial Consolidation Ownership: Take full ownership of the end-to-end financial consolidation process across multiple entities/revenue streams,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and timely monthly, quarterly, and annual reporting. - Critical Thinking & Analysis: Look beyond the surface level of the financial data. Identify trends, anticipate risks, and uncover hidden opportunities to optimize cash flow and profitability. - FP&A and Modeling: Build, maintain, and scale robust financial models (Three-Statement models, forecasting, and scenario planning) that reflect the fast-changing realities of a startup. -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with teams across the organization to streamline budget processes, track KPIs, and instill financial discipline without sacrificing startup speed. YOU ARE: - Startup DNA: 4+ years of progressive finance experience, with a proven track record of thriving in a fast-paced, ambiguous startup or high-growth environment. You know how to build processes where none exist. - Consolidation Expertise: Demonstrated experience owning the financial consolidation process across business units or entities. - Power-User Data Skills: Elite proficiency in both Excel and Google Sheets. You can build complex, clean, and scalable models, but you also know when a simple, elegant solution is better. - Executive Presence: Exceptional communication and presentation skills. You can confidently articulate financial concepts and defend strategic recommendations to C-suite executives and board members. - Problem-Solving Mindset: Strong critical thinking skills with a natural curiosity to dig into data, challenge assumptions, and solve complex business problems. - Education: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related field. Professional certifications (CPA, CFA, or MBA) are a strong plus.
